The Formuler Z11 Pro Max is a premium Android 11 OTT media streamer designed for professional-grade 4K HDR streaming and gaming. Equipped with a RealTek RTD1319C CPU, Mali-G57 GPU, 4GB DDR4 RAM, and 32GB storage, it supports Wi-Fi 6 AX 2x2, Gigabit Ethernet, and Bluetooth 5.0 for robust connectivity. Its clean, ad-free interface and Widevine L1 DRM enable seamless access to premium content from Netflix, Prime Video, and more, making it an ideal choice for cord-cutting millennials seeking high performance and customization.

A product that means business. First and foremost: Subscribe to a PAID VPN. There are many excellent ones out there. I will recommend NordVPN. I like the features such as: It is a professional-grade Android OTT media streamer designed for 4K HDR streaming and gaming on your TV. It runs on Android 11 and features Widevine Level 1 DRM for premium content playback. I recommend the BT1 (blue tooth) Voice remote. It works well. It is quite responsive. The home screen is free of ads and widgets you can’t remove. Customize app placement and pin MYTVOnline3 channels for direct access. This clean layout prioritizes quick launch of favorite apps and live streams without distractions. Equipped with a Mali-G57 GPU and 4 GB of RAM, the Z11 Pro Max tackles graphic-intensive games and high-bitrate video playback with minimal lag and fast menu navigation. Embedded Widevine L1 DRM ensures compatibility with Netflix, Prime Video, and other premium 4K services. My total was $140 per mo. including Netflix before. Now, it is $55. The savings buy me a lot of beer. LOL. Pros Outstanding 4K HDR decoding with AV1 support. Clean, ad-free interface with customizable UI Robust connectivity: Wi-Fi 6, Gigabit Ethernet, Bluetooth 5.0. iPV6 enabled. Record shows. It may not record one while watching another channel. I have to investigate this further. Cons 32 GB storage may fill quickly with large app libraries. I have a 128 GB thumb drive to counter the problem. Premium features hinge on compatible service-provider subscriptions. Higher price point than basic streaming sticks. Old adage: You get what you pay for.
